Good to see the men's kayak single 200s getting broadcast.

 

With canoe sprint only getting 2 World Cup regattas per season as of late, it'll be interesting to see who wins that event in Heath's absence (with only the WCh still to come) as the top guys are mostly European. I don't know why Beaumont and Seja were made to share a heat, though (which the former won to qualify directly for the final).

 

On another note - if Google's translation of this Swedish article is correct, there will be a medal reallocation ceremony for Menning w.r.t the previous Euro Games K1M 200 (upgrade to gold after the disqualification of Miklós Dudás). McKeever (silver), Rumjancevs and Dragosavljević (both bronze!) will also get their medals at some point, be it in Minsk or elsewhere.
